The Limitations of Traditional Mental Wellness Approaches
Mental wellness professionals and individuals alike have long recognized the importance of mindfulness and self-care in maintaining a healthy mind. However, traditional methods often fall short in providing personalized and scalable support. For instance, conventional mindfulness apps rely on generic meditation scripts and one-size-fits-all approaches, which can lead to user boredom and disengagement (Kabat-Zinn, 2003). Furthermore, human therapists and counselors face limitations in terms of availability and accessibility, particularly for individuals in remote or underserved areas.
Artificial intelligence (AI) has the potential to revolutionize mental wellness by offering a more tailored and accessible approach to mindfulness and self-care. AI-powered mindfulness apps can employ machine learning algorithms to analyze user behavior, preferences, and mental health data to provide personalized meditation sessions, c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) exercises, and mood tracking. These AI-driven tools can also learn from user feedback and adapt to individual needs over time. Overcoming Implementation Barriers: Strategies for Seamless Integration of AI-Powered Mindfulness into Healthcare Systems
Integration of AI-powered mindfulness into healthcare systems can be a game-changer for mental wellness, but it often faces implementation barriers. These barriers can be overcome with strategic planning and the right approach.
One key challenge is ensuring seamless integration with existing electronic health records (EHRs). This can be achieved by selecting mindfulness apps that use standardized APIs and data exchange protocols, such as FHIR (Fast Healthcare Interoperability Resources). For instance, the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A) Health System successfully integrated a mindfulness app with their EHR system, resulting in a 30% increase in patient engagement with mindfulness programs.
AI drives measurable improvement by providing data-driven insights to healthcare providers, enabling them to tailor mindfulness interventions to individual patient needs. By leveraging machine learning algorithms, AI-powered mindfulness apps can also monitor patient progress, identifying areas for improvement and suggesting personalized recommendations. This data-driven approach can lead to more effective treatment outcomes and improved patient satisfaction.
